携帯用Web画面のリファーラ値の取得方法
環境
サーバLinux、Apache2.0.52、PHP4.3.9
携帯用Webを作成し、携帯電話からアクセスしてきた時のリンク元をgetenv("http_referer")を使用し情報を取得したいのですが取得できない状態です。尚、PCの場合は取得可能です。
log.html(対象画面)
<body>
このページへのアクセスが記録
<img border="0" src="http://****/log.php" width="1" height="1">
</body>
log.php(記録)
<?php
require "config.php";
$conn = mysql_connect($sv, $user, $pass) or die("接続エラー");
mysql_select_db($dbname) or die("接続エラー");
// 値をセット
$log_date = date("Y-m-d");
$log_time = date("H:i:s");
$log_ip = getenv("remote_addr");
$log_url = getenv("http_referer");
// データの追加
$sql = "INSERT INTO log ("
. " log_date, "
. " log_time, "
. " log_ip, "
. " log_url "
. ") values ("
. "'" . $log_date . "',"
. "'" . $log_time . "',"
. "'" . $log_ip . "',"
. "'" . $log_url . "'"
. ")";
mysql_query($sql, $conn);
?>
どうかご指導のほど宜しくお願いします。